Output e00dc70e6c9d6c807df89b1594f45d97018faa3995b1e1cf74c71ffcd5fa6715:3

value
32328288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5ff1a36a99e874bdb1ba40886cd384b2aef14d3 OP_EQUAL
address
MRx4x3d796BmG6QeVZnqLrda64N5so6ZbP
transaction
e00dc70e6c9d6c807df89b1594f45d97018faa3995b1e1cf74c71ffcd5fa6715
spent
true